Green Card Gets a New Face Lift!
Posted
Nov 26, 2004
The United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) announced on
November 15, 2004 that there has been a change made to the appearance of the
plastic "green card," or I-551 card, which evidences lawful permanent
resident status. The I-551 cards issued on or after November 15, 2004
feature the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) seal on the front. The
back of the card includes the words "Department of Homeland Security." The
card also has unspecified, enhanced security features.

Previously-issued I-551 cards will remain valid until the expiration dates
indicated on them, unless they are recalled by the USCIS sometime in the
future. Currently, it is not expected that the USCIS will recall these cards
en masse.
